A very brief survey about the Fick’s and thermodynamic diffusion coefficients and the main expressions of its prediction in gas, liquid, and electrolyte solution as well as dense and porous membranes is given. For dense membranes, the Flory–Huggins approach is recommended to predict the chemical potential and from that, the diffusion coefficient. For porous membranes, the diffusion coefficient is given, depending on the ratio of the pore size and size of the solute molecules. Mass transfer rate is defined due to the diffusion in concentrated solution. At the end, the ionic transport and the hindrance factors are listed depending on the molecule size and pore size.
